The DOL filing record for Teachers College, Columbia University

U.S. Department of Labor's OFLC discloses 35 Labor Condition Application filings naming Teachers College, Columbia University from FY2023 through FY2026, drawn directly from DOL's quarterly public disclosure releases. An LCA is the wage-and-working-conditions attestation an employer files with DOL before petitioning USCIS for an H-1B worker: it is a filing record, not a USCIS approval, a job offer, or a confirmed hire, and the count reflects filings, not people, since an employer sponsoring the same role at more than one worksite, or refiling across fiscal years, is counted once per filing. DOL LCA release change

What changed between the two LCA fiscal years

FY2024 -> FY2025
  • Teachers College, Columbia University's disclosed H-1B LCA filing count rose from 6 in FY2024 to 10 in FY2025 (+66.7%).
  • Teachers College, Columbia University's average disclosed H-1B offered wage rose from $113,188 in FY2024 to $121,760 in FY2025 (+7.6%).

Arithmetic differences between stored DOL OFLC Labor Condition Application disclosure fiscal years for this employer identity - not a headcount, hire forecast, or cause claim. Role mix can shift between years even when the filing total is flat. Totals group name variants that share the same identity key.

Above-prevailing wage posture

On 35 LCAs with comparable offered vs prevailing wages, Teachers College, Columbia University averages about 55.6% above the prevailing wage (national baseline ≈ 17.8%). Dominant PW level on file: Entry (Level I) (37.1% of LCA filings).

New York, NY worksite concentration

Only 35 LCAs on file for Teachers College, Columbia University, and 77.1% land in NEW YORK, NY. Treat rates as descriptive of a small sample. DOL cert on file: 100%.
